Fuel System Pressure Test
1. Before servicing fuel system components, fuel system pressure must be released. To relieve pressure, proceed as follows:a. Remove fuel pump fuse from fuse block.
b. Run engine until fuel remaining in lines is consumed. When engine shuts down, engage starter for approximately three seconds to relieve any remaining pressure.
c. With ignition off, replace fuel pump fuse.
2. Remove fuel line between TBI unit and fuel filter. Use a suitable back-up wrench to hold flare nut on throttle body when removing line.
3. Install fuel pressure gauge J-29658 or equivalent, between throttle body and filter.
4. Check pressure reading with engine running. Fuel pressure should be between 9 and 13 psi.
5. De-pressurize fuel system, remove pressure gauge and reinstall fuel line.
6. Start engine and check for fuel leaks.
